What is your risk profile?

What is your risk profile?

A risk profile indicates how likely it is that you may become disabled due to your working life.

Are you not sure what this means or which profile your job falls under? Then read the explanation below, including examples of relevant occupations.

Low risk profile

A low risk profile means your job involves little physical effort or hazards. This typically applies to professions that are mainly sedentary or mentally focused.
Examples: web designer, administrative assistant, accountant, graphic designer.

Low AOV Risk

Medium risk profile

A medium risk profile means your job is sometimes physically demanding or involves certain risks. This applies to professions that involve regular movement or physical activity.
Examples: cleaner, hairdresser, photographer, nurse, driving instructor.

Medium AOV Risk

High risk profile

A high risk profile means your job is physically demanding or carries a higher chance of injury. This usually applies to professions that involve heavy lifting, working outdoors, and/or using tools.
Examples: paver, plasterer, landscaper, bricklayer, installation technician.

How to find the best disability insurance?

For self-employed professionals, freelancers, and entrepreneurs, it’s important to choose a occupational disability insurance (called AOV for short in Dutch) that suits both your personal and business situation.

There can be significant differences between insurers in terms of coverage, premiums, conditions, and flexibility.

Think about rent, mortgage, groceries, and other expenses that still need to be paid, even if you become (partially) unable to work.

It could be smart to assess your situation. Use the questions below for this.

1. What are your fixed monthly expenses?

Your fixed expenses, such as rent or mortgage, groceries, and insurance – give an idea of the minimum amount you should insure.


2. How long can you go without an income?

If you have savings or other financial buffers, you can opt for a longer waiting period (e.g., 3 or 6 months) before the insurance kicks in. This significantly lowers your premium.


3. Do you want coverage for your own profession?

Disability insurance policies differ in how well they cover your own occupation. Also consider additional options like coverage for mental health issues and pregnancy.

What is and isn’t covered by disability insurance?

What is covered?

  • Disability due to physical or mental health issues
  • Disability resulting from activities at work, at home, on vacation, or during sports
  • Temporary inability to work due to pregnancy (depending on your policy)
  • Personalized guidance during the period you are unable to work

What isn’t covered?

  • When your disability cannot be appointed to a medical cause
  • If you are less than 25 percent occupationally disabled
  • If your disability is caused by addiction to alcohol or drugs
  • If your disability involves intent or reckless behavior

Is disability insurance compulsory?

As of this moment (May 2025), as a self-employed entrepreneur, it is not compulsory to take out disability insurance (AOV) in The Netherlands.

However, the Dutch government is working on a plan for a mandatory basic disability insurance (BAZ) for self-employed individuals.

The introduction of this plan was originally scheduled for January 1st, 2027. However, this plan has been postponed because implementation proved unfeasible.


The mandatory disability insurance (AOV) for self-employed workers is expected to be introduced on January 1st, 2030.

What to expect for the compulsory AOV?

  • The obligation applies to all self-employed individuals who declare business profits to the Dutch Tax Administration.
  • The cost is approximately 6,5% of your income, with a maximum of 195 euros per month.
  • The compulsory insurance covers 70% your income, with a maximum of 100% of the minimum wage.
